Output 30a23884df0dbe28eb9682ed04d18cf31768b2f56b08c4919de24b06a471da11:3

value
1394966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41de741237ffaeee83095c27bf06254052df5fed OP_EQUAL
address
37hJLM2fXQRLs2wnPa1ZYqJfREstzS8LtK
transaction
30a23884df0dbe28eb9682ed04d18cf31768b2f56b08c4919de24b06a471da11
confirmations
181516
spent
true